thanks for providing this example. The one WebDriver instance is
correctly managed in the WebDriverProvider.end() method.
The FluentWebDriver instances are not managed in the same way - they are
not WebDriver instances and there is no lifecycle management. There
is an instance created for each page, each using the same WebDriver
instance as delegate.
I'm not sure this constitutes a memory leak, simply that the instances
are not removed at the end of the story execution. But that could
easily apply to other objects as well.
Are you experiencing any specific issues as a consequence of this? If
so, I'd would add a FluentLifecycleSteps class method that finds the
ThreadLocal instances of FluentWebDriver and nullifies them, and we can
annotate it @AfterStory.

As you can see, by the time the suite is over, there are 4
FluentWebDriver instances (one for each page object that is created)
attached to the current thread.
On the other hand, you may notice that the
*DoublyOverriddenFirefoxDriver *is removed correctly.

Hi,
the FluentWebDriverPage is simply a fluent-based facade
using a FluentWebDriver. The underlying
WebDriverProvider is the same as a non-fluent page and
is injected in the constructor.
The PerStoryWebDriverSteps should use exactly the same
underlying WebDriverProvider (autowired via some
dependency-injection mechanism), so if the provider
end() method is invoked you shouldn't need to do
anything else.

Hi all !
I've added the jbehave-web module to a personal
project where I use testng. I'm using the
FirefoxWebDriverProvider to manage the webdriver
instances, taking advantage of the ThreadLocal for
multithreaded tests.
My question is, even though I call the end() method
every time a test completes to remove the driver
assigned to the current thread, i don't know how to
the same thing to the FluentWebDriver (a thread
local variable that the FluentWebDriverPage has).
I noticed that , for example, the
PerStoryWebDriverSteps only executes
driverProvider.end() but as in mentioned above, i
didn't find any clean up for the FluentWebDriver
instances that FluentWebDriverPage creates.
